Designed for business Ethernet and mobile backhaul applications, the ION NIDs have been certified compliant to MEF 9, MEF 14 and MEF 21 requirements. The compliance tests and certification process were performed by Iometrix, Inc., a leading independent testing lab, on behalf of the MEF.
The MEF Carrier Ethernet Certification Program is designed to ensure that global equipment and services comply with MEF standards and pave the way for interoperability. MEF 9 and MEF 14 equipment certifications ensure delivery of compliant, high performance Carrier Ethernet services at the User Network Interface (UNI). MEF 9 verifies service delivery and functionality. MEF 9 consists of 244 test cases which cover the Ethernet Physical Interface, UNI Attributes, Service Frame Delivery and VLAN Tag support. MEF 14 verifies service performance and bandwidth profiles. MEF 14 consists of 170 test cases which cover Service Performance, Bandwidth Profiles and Bandwidth Rate Enforcement. MEF 21 certifies Link OAM functions of the MEF UNI Type 2. MEF 21 is based on IEEE 802.3-2005 Clause 57 and is key for large scale automated management of Carrier Ethernet service links. MEF 21 consists of 371 test cases which cover OAM Discovery, OAM PDUs and OAM TLVs.
